2. Key Factors to Consider

Material Characteristics: Analyze the physical and magnetic properties of the feed material. Key parameters include particle size, shape, density, moisture content, and magnetic susceptibility. For example, fine particles may require high-gradient separators, while coarse materials might be handled by drum separators.

Separation Objectives: Define whether you need to remove tramp iron, concentrate magnetic minerals, or purify non-magnetic products. The required grade and recovery rate will dictate the separator type and intensity.

Operating Conditions: Consider throughput capacity, temperature, humidity, and space constraints. Wet processes may need slurry handling capabilities, while dry processes must account for dust and flowability.

Equipment Types: Common types include magnetic drums, pulleys, overhead magnets, magnetic filters, and eddy current separators. Each has specific advantages for different applications.

3. Types of Magnetic Separators

Dry vs. Wet Separation: Dry separators (e.g., drum, pulley) are suitable for granular materials with low moisture. Wet separators (e.g., WHIMS, LIMS) handle slurries and fine particles, offering higher efficiency for mineral processing.

Low-Intensity vs. High-Intensity: Low-intensity separators (typically <1 Tesla) are used for strongly magnetic materials like magnetite. High-intensity separators (up to 2 Tesla or more) capture weakly magnetic particles such as hematite or ilmenite.

Permanent vs. Electromagnetic: Permanent magnets (e.g., neodymium, ferrite) require no power supply, have lower operating costs, and are maintenance-free. Electromagnets offer adjustable field strength but consume electricity and generate heat.

4. Performance Metrics and Testing

Key metrics include magnetic field strength and gradient, recovery rate, grade, and capacity. Always conduct lab-scale tests using representative samples to validate performance. 5. Industry Applications

  • Mining: Beneficiation of iron ore, rare earth minerals, and industrial minerals.
  • Recycling: Separation of ferrous metals from municipal solid waste, e-waste, and scrap metal.
  • Food & Pharmaceutical: Removal of metal contaminants to ensure product safety.
  • Chemical & Plastic: Purification of raw materials and protection of processing equipment.
